Responsibilities

  • Check products for quality and identify damaged or expired goods.
  • Set oven temperatures and place items into hot ovens for baking.
  • Measure or weigh flour or other ingredients to prepare batters, doughs, fillings, or icings, using scales or graduated containers.
  • Decorate baked goods, such as cakes or pastries.
  • Roll, knead, cut, or shape dough to form sweet rolls, pie crusts, tarts, cookies, or other products.
  • Develop new recipes for baked goods.
  • Check the quality of raw materials to ensure that standards and specifications are met.
  • Check equipment to ensure that it meets health and safety regulations and perform maintenance or cleaning, as necessary.
  • Wash pots, pans, dishes, utensils, or other cooking equipment.
  • Adhere to and promote company standards for safety, proper food handling practices, sanitation, uniform guidelines, and productivity.
  • May assist in supporting culinary staff at numerous stations as directed.
  • Provide excellent customer service, and be attentive, approachable, greeting and thanking customers.
  • May per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
